Mesero - Victory Park offers an elevated Mexican dining experience in a great location. The restaurant serves delectable dishes and refreshing drinks, making it a fabulous place to dine. The ambiance is excellent, and while the service is usually prompt, it can be slow during busy times. The menu caters to both novice and adventurous diners. With validated parking available, Mesero is a highly recommended spot, perfect for a meal before a show or a hockey game.
The restaurant features a large outdoor patio area for alfresco dining, which is especially appreciated during nice weather. Customers consistently praise the food, with favorites like the blackened salmon, ceviche, breakfast tacos, and chicken tacos. The drinks, including the excellent Mesorita and the popular mangonada, are also highlights. Many guests enjoy the shrimp tacos, which feature sautéed shrimp on flour tortillas. The staff is friendly and attentive, with some reviews mentioning fast service and helpful staff who show guests various sauces and dips for their chips. The atmosphere is lively, but it can get loud, making conversation a bit challenging at times.
Though the Victory Park location may not be as impressive as the Clearfork counterpart, the food and service remain commendable. The restaurant is particularly popular among those seeking a satisfying and enjoyable Mexican dining experience, especially for casual dinners, drinks, or a quick meal before events.
